#b1f698 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b1f698 is composed of 69.4% red, 96.5%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 28% cyan, 0% magenta, 38.2% yellow and 3.5% black. It has a hue angle of 104 degrees, a saturation of 83.9% and a lightness of 78%. #b1f698 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#63ed31. Closest websafe color is: #99ff99.

Shades and Tints of #b1f698
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020500 is the darkest color, while #f5fef2 is the lightest one.
